§ 51A-5-27 — Reports of committees designated to supervise fiduciary accounts.
The committees provided for in §§ 51A-5-25 and 51A-5-26 shall keep minutes of their meetings, and shall fully report to the board of directors at least once in each calendar quarter all action taken since their previous report.
